The Pastor was speaking on Freedom in Christ, one of my passion topics and he made this statement:
“There are 3 kinds of people in this room right now…there are:
1) Orphans
2) Slaves
3) Free Son’s and Daughters of God
He proceeded to describe those 3 places of life in what some may have felt was a pretty aggressive, “cut-to-the-chase” style.
I loved his description of those CHOICES one makes for life.
1) Orphans: A Parent-less Child. One who does not know his or her Abba Father.
2) Slave: One held in bondage or captivity by another person or situation–lies, wounds, heartbreak, failure, loss–that is build upon by Satan.
3) Free Son or Daughter of God: One who knows his or her Abba Father as well as the rights and privileges that provides and lives a life that reflects it.

Paul leads this diatribe into a very clear checklist to ask the questions we need to answer in order to SEE for ourselves which of those 3 lives we are living.
Here it is. You may want to refresh you mind on it like I did today:
The Galatians 5 —-Checklist of Orphans and Slaves
Sexual Immorality, Impurity, Debauchery
Idolatry and Witchcraft
Hatred, Discord, Fits of Rage, Dissension
Jealousy and Envy
Drunkenness
Selfish Ambition
Checklist of FREEDOM—
Joy, Peace, Love
Patience, Kindness, Self Control
Gentleness, Faithfulness, Goodness.
